Opening of the new H&M Flagship Store on Gran Vía, Madrid

Architecture, experience, and transformation in one of the city's most iconic commercial landmarks.

The new H&M Flagship Store at Gran Vía 32, Madrid, recently reopened its doors after completing an extensive renovation of the commercial space, marking a new milestone in the evolution of one of the brand’s most representative stores in Spain.

The inauguration marked the official unveiling of H&M’s new store concept in a strategic retail location in Madrid, bringing together industry professionals, brand representatives, and a selection of celebrities and influencers. During the event, attendees had the opportunity to explore the space and experience firsthand the new architectural organization, interior layouts, and spatial solutions developed in the project.

Beyond the inaugural event, the reopening signified the launch of a project designed to meet the current demands of retail, both functionally and technically. The intervention completely transformed the interior of the store, adapting it to a more open, fluid, and contemporary shopping experience, in line with the brand’s evolving concept.

The store is organized across several clearly articulated levels, with a precise spatial arrangement and seamless connections between floors. Unique elements such as the central staircase play a central role, structuring the circulation and reinforcing the visual continuity of the space. The interior architecture, along with the selection of materials and lighting design, complements the commercial use of the space and enhances the user experience while maintaining a coherent relationship with the urban context of Gran Vía.

This project marks the beginning of a new phase for the store, now fully integrated into the dynamic atmosphere of one of Madrid’s most active and iconic commercial arteries.
